    Manus

    Manus

    An AI agent designed to handle complex tasks all by itself

    Manus is a new AI agent from China that’s been making waves in the tech world. It is designed to handle complex tasks all by itself, with the idea to bridge the gap between thinking and doing.

    The platform can handle all kinds of tasks in work and life, “getting everything done while you rest” — as it says. In fact, Manus’ homepage features some of the most popular use cases, giving you an idea of what you can expect from it.

    For instance, it can handle all the planning related to one’s travels, deeply analyze stocks, prepare interactive courses, or perform a comparative analysis of insurance policies. In addition, it can help with B2B supplier sourcing, research on different products for various industries, and analyze online store operations — all with little to no human intervention. In a way, it’s like having a dedicated employee doing all the work for you — at a fraction of the cost.

    Lastly, we’ll mention that Manus has achieved new state-of-the-art (SOTA) performance across all three difficulty levels in GAIA benchmark — which is used for evaluating General AI Assistants on solving real-world problems. Impressive.

    What are the key features? ✨

    • Works like a smart assistant: Manus can think and do things for you. You can give it a task, and it will figure out how to do it step by step.
    • Build apps: Just type what kind of an app you want, and it will code it for you. No need to install anything.
    • Plans and books things: If you ask Manus to plan a trip, it doesn't just give you advice. It searches flights, finds hotels, and puts everything together like a real travel agent.
    • Understands multiple steps at once: Instead of just answering one thing at a time, Manus handles big tasks that involve lots of steps. It connects the dots like a smart human helper.
    • Constantly improving & learning: Manus is getting smarter with each version, and soon might do much more than today.

    FAQs 💬

    What is Manus AI, and what makes it different from other AI tools?
    Manus AI is an autonomous AI agent that turns high-level ideas into complete actions, like building apps or running research, without constant user input. It stands out because it plans, executes, and optimizes multi-step tasks on its own, using a team of specialized sub-agents for things like memory and tool use. I think this makes it feel more like a digital worker than a simple chatbot, though it might take some getting used to for beginners.
    How do I get started with Manus AI if I'm new to it?
    Head to manus.im and sign up, no waitlist needed anymore. You'll get free credits right away to test it out, and you can earn more by inviting friends. Just describe what you want in plain English, and Manus handles the rest. It's pretty straightforward, but probably start with simple tasks to see how it flows.
    What are the main features of Manus AI?
    Key features include autonomous task execution, like creating full-stack web apps with databases and payments via Stripe integration, deep research with real-time web browsing, code generation and deployment, and even image or video creation from prompts. Recent updates in version 1.5 make it four times faster, with better reasoning and team collaboration options. It shines in handling complex workflows, but context limits can trip it up on super long projects.
    How much does Manus AI cost, and what do credits mean?
    Manus runs on a credit system, where free users get a starter amount, and paid plans start around $20 for more credits, up to enterprise levels. Credits power tasks, with simple ones using fewer and big builds eating hundreds. You might find it pricey if you're heavy on coding or research, since costs vary by complexity, but refunds are possible for failed runs.
    Is Manus AI good for building websites or apps?
    Yes, it's strong here. Users often praise how it researches trends, generates React code, and deploys functional sites, like landing pages with booking systems. One review built a full SaaS app in minutes. That said, it sometimes needs fixes for bugs or forgets details mid-build, so expect a bit of tweaking.
    Can Manus AI handle research or data analysis tasks?
    Absolutely, it's a go-to for deep dives, like competitor analysis or pulling apartment listings with details. It compiles reports, charts sentiments, and even turns findings into slides. Compared to tools like ChatGPT Deep Research, it often delivers more structured outputs, though processing can drag on for massive datasets.
    What are some real user experiences with Manus AI?
    Feedback is mixed but leans positive for power users. One developer built a non-profit site and scripted a call to waive a $994 bill. Others love the speed for prototypes, but complain about credit drain on trials or interruptions in quality mode. On Trustpilot, scores hover around average due to billing hiccups, yet Reddit threads highlight its edge in automation.
    Are there any limitations or common issues with Manus AI?
    It can be slow on intricate tasks, burn through credits fast, and struggle with long contexts or auth barriers, like logging into sites. Some report random charges or unresponsive support. I think it's best for focused projects rather than endless sessions, and the app has occasional bugs like spacebar glitches.
    How does Manus AI compare to competitors like ChatGPT or Claude?
    Manus edges out in autonomy for end-to-end builds, topping GAIA benchmarks for practical problem-solving, while ChatGPT feels more conversational but less hands-off. Claude handles code well, but Manus integrates tools like Stripe seamlessly. If you're after quick chats, stick with others; for full automation, Manus might win, though it's pricier.
    Is Manus AI suitable for teams or businesses?
    Definitely, with shared sessions, collaboration invites, and enterprise plans for high-volume use. It's great for workflows like market reports or app prototyping in teams. Businesses note the time savings, like cutting 20-hour tasks to one, but scale carefully to avoid credit surprises.
